如何解决AI语音SDK中的口音识别问题?
在人工智能技术飞速发展的今天,语音识别技术已经渗透到我们生活的方方面面。从智能家居的语音助手,到智能手机的语音搜索,再到智能客服的语音交互,语音识别技术正逐渐改变着我们的生活方式。然而,在AI语音SDK的应用过程中,口音识别问题一直是一个难以攻克的技术难题。本文将通过一个真实的故事,讲述如何解决AI语音SDK中的口音识别问题。
故事的主人公是一位名叫李明的年轻人,他是一名语音识别工程师,致力于研究如何提高AI语音SDK的口音识别能力。李明所在的公司是一家专注于智能语音技术的初创企业,他们的产品在市场上受到了广泛的关注。然而,在产品推广过程中,客户们反映了一个普遍的问题——口音识别不准确。
李明意识到,这个问题如果不解决,将严重影响产品的用户体验和市场竞争力。于是,他决定从以下几个方面入手,攻克口音识别难题。
首先,李明对现有的口音识别算法进行了深入研究。他发现,传统的口音识别算法大多基于统计模型,这些模型在处理不同口音的语音数据时,往往会出现误识别的情况。为了解决这个问题,李明尝试将深度学习技术引入到口音识别领域。
深度学习是一种模拟人脑神经网络结构的算法,具有强大的特征提取和模式识别能力。李明认为,通过深度学习技术,可以更好地捕捉语音信号中的口音特征,从而提高口音识别的准确性。
接下来,李明开始收集大量的口音数据。这些数据包括普通话、方言、外语等不同口音的语音样本。为了确保数据的多样性和代表性,他甚至亲自录制了不同地区、不同年龄、不同性别的口音样本。
在收集到足够的数据后,李明开始构建一个多口音语音数据库。这个数据库包含了多种口音的语音样本,可以用于训练和测试AI语音SDK的口音识别能力。
在构建数据库的过程中,李明遇到了一个难题:如何处理不同口音之间的差异。为了解决这个问题,他采用了以下几种方法:
特征提取:通过提取语音信号中的音素、音节、音调等特征,将不同口音的语音样本进行分类。
增强学习:利用增强学习算法,让AI模型在训练过程中不断学习,适应不同口音的语音特点。
混合模型:结合多种深度学习模型,如卷积神经网络(CNN)、循环神经网络(RNN)和长短期记忆网络(LSTM)等,提高口音识别的准确性。
经过几个月的努力,李明终于构建了一个具有较高口音识别能力的AI语音SDK。为了验证其效果,他组织了一次内部测试。测试结果显示,新SDK在口音识别方面的准确率达到了90%以上,远高于传统算法。
然而,李明并没有满足于此。他意识到,口音识别问题是一个复杂且不断发展的领域,需要持续进行研究和优化。于是,他开始着手解决以下问题:
提高实时性:在保证准确率的前提下,降低AI语音SDK的响应时间,提高用户体验。
扩展适用范围:将AI语音SDK应用于更多场景,如车载语音、智能家居等。
提高鲁棒性:在嘈杂环境中,提高AI语音SDK的抗干扰能力。
在接下来的时间里,李明和他的团队不断优化AI语音SDK,使其在口音识别方面取得了显著的成果。他们的产品得到了越来越多客户的认可,市场占有率也在不断提升。
通过这个故事,我们可以看到,解决AI语音SDK中的口音识别问题并非易事,但只要我们勇于创新、不断探索,就一定能够攻克这个难题。而对于李明来说,这不仅仅是一个技术挑战,更是他实现自我价值、推动行业发展的重要机遇。
猜你喜欢:AI陪聊软件